The following information came from a book entitled: Marriage Licensing Laws:A State by State Guide, by Roger E. Kessinger. It was published in 1990 by Kessinger Publishing Co.; P.O. Box 8933, Boise, ID 83707.
A word of caution, the information I gathered may not be accurate or may no longer be accurate. Accordingly I would suggest double checking all information with local authorities. In most jurisdictions, illegally performing a marriage ceremony is a misdemeanor and may result in a fine of up to one-hundred dollars and up to ninety days in jail. So please, double-check.
The following information is categorized by name of state, the office to be contacted for information, the paragraphs relevant to performing the solemnization of matrimony and any special requirements. Unless any special requirements are listed, it is usually any ordained minister, priest, or rabbi of any religious denomination in good standing and over eighteen years old.
